What companies run services between Hyatt Regency London Stratford, England and Trafalgar Square, England?

Elizabeth Line (TfL) operates a train from Stratford to Tottenham Court Road Station every 15 minutes. Tickets cost £4–9 and the journey takes 14 min. Alternatively, Stagecoach London operates a bus from Stratford Bus Station to Tottenham Court Road Station every 15 minutes. Tickets cost £2 and the journey takes 38 min.
